Nasi Goreng rarely gets the international recognition it deserves. The deeply spiced with galangal and lemongrass complexity is genuine, not simple, and the technique involved in using coconut milk correctly takes real skill.

Indonesian cuisine spans over 17,000 islands with dramatically different regional traditions. I encountered it first in a family feast table and that context helped me understand it properly. es teh manis iced sweet tea is the natural accompaniment and the combination makes the case for the dish. If you haven't explored this cuisine seriously, Nasi Goreng is the dish to start with.
